How does OI affect the trading volume of cryptocurrencies?
AudreyMay 04, 2022 · 4 years ago6 answers
What is the relationship between Open Interest (OI) and the trading volume of cryptocurrencies? How does OI impact the liquidity and market activity in the crypto market?
6 answers
- Faircloth ChristoffersenMar 20, 2024 · 2 years agoOpen Interest (OI) is a key metric in the cryptocurrency market that measures the total number of outstanding contracts or positions held by traders. It represents the total amount of money invested in a particular cryptocurrency derivative. OI can have a significant impact on the trading volume of cryptocurrencies. When OI is high, it indicates a high level of market participation and interest in a particular cryptocurrency. This increased interest often leads to higher trading volume as more traders are actively buying and selling the cryptocurrency. On the other hand, when OI is low, it suggests a lack of interest and participation, which can result in lower trading volume.

- Kalyan NaiduFeb 14, 2023 · 3 years agoThe impact of OI on trading volume can vary depending on the specific cryptocurrency and market conditions. In some cases, high OI may lead to increased trading volume, indicating a strong market trend. However, in other cases, high OI may result in decreased trading volume due to market saturation or a lack of new participants. It is essential to consider other factors such as market sentiment, news events, and technical analysis when analyzing the relationship between OI and trading volume in cryptocurrencies.
